Gieles' Ladies Help Him Double

Nivel 12 : Blinds 1,000/2,000, 2,000 ante

With roughly 33,000 in the pot on a flop of J33, David Coleman checked from early position and Luuk Gieles bet 9,000 from the seat next to him. Sirzat Hissou called from the button, but Coleman folded.

Gieles bet 15,000 on the J turn with around 25,000 behind. Hissou shoved to put Gieles all-in, and Gieles called.

Luuk Gieles: QQ All in
Sirzat Hissou: 44

Gieles was ahead with his ladies, only having to avoid a four on the river. The 9 came on the river and Gieles had doubled up.

Coleman Snaps Off O'Dwyer

Nivel 12 : Blinds 1,000/2,000, 2,000 ante

Heads-up on a flop of K32, David Coleman bet 7,500 from the hijack, Steve O'Dwyer raised to 17,000 in middle position, and Coleman called.

The turn was the 5 and O'Dwyer moved all in for 30,000. Coleman snap-called and turned over AA, while O'Dwyer needed help holding KQ. The river was the 9 and Coleman took the pot to send the EPT champion to the rail.

Bitar Runs Into Aces

Nivel 12 : Blinds 1,000/2,000, 2,000 ante
Ghassan Bitar
Ghassan Bitar

Ryan Mandara raised to 4,000 from under the gun and Robert Heidorn flat called in early position. Ghassan Bitar moved all in from the button for 27,000, Mandara folded and Heidorn made the call to put Bitar at risk.

Ghassan Bitar: AK All in
Robert Heidorn: AA

Bitar found no help on a board of 9Q436 and Heidorn won the pot, eliminating Bitar from the tournament.

Toda Busts Saydam Set-Over-Set

Nivel 12 : Blinds 1,000/2,000, 2,000 ante

Heads-up on a board of A536, Ozgur Saydam bet 10,000 from middle position and Yasuaki Toda raised to 25,000 in the cutoff. Saydam tanked for a minute before moving all in for 35,000, and Toda snap-called.

Saydam had 33 for a set of threes, but Toda showed 55 for a set of fives as the Q fell on the river to send Saydam to the rail.

Payouts Released; €1,512,000 for First Place

Nivel 12 : Blinds 1,000/2,000, 2,000 ante
Trophy
Trophy

The 2024 EPT Barcelona Main Event has set the poker world on fire with the 1,975 entries creating a substantial €9,578,750 prize pool!

The top 287 players are guaranteed a slice of the action, with six-figure payouts kicking in from 11th place. The top three will receive:

🏆 Champion's Prize: €1,512,000
🥈 Runner-Up: €944,000
🥉 3rd Place: €674,150

Cash is on the line for hundreds of players, with payouts starting at €8,700 and going all the way up to the life-changing €1.5 million for first place! Take a look at the full payout table below.

PlacePrizePlacePrizePlacePrize
1€1,512,00010-11€107,45040-55€23,350
2€944,00012-13€89,55056-71€20,300
3€674,15014-15€74,60072-95€17,600
4€518,60016-17€62,15096-119€15,350
5€398,95018-20€51,800120-143€13,300
6€306,90021-23€43,200144-183€11,600
7€236,10024-27€36,000184-223€10,050
8€181,60028-31€30,950224-287€8,700
9€139,75032-39€26,900

NAPT Las Vegas Schedule Released, $3M GTD Main Event Headlines Series

Nivel 12 : Blinds 1,000/2,000, 2,000 ante
NAPT
NAPT

The fourth season of the North American Poker Tour (NAPT) run by PokerStars is well underway and the action only continues to heat up with the recent schedule release for its marquee stop in Las Vegas. Running from Friday November 1st through Sunday November 10th at Resorts World Las Vegas, the series is not one to miss as it features a whopping 36 tournaments in the span of a week and a half.

Buy-ins range from just $250 all the way up to $25,000 so there are plenty of options for those who want to enjoy some live tournament action without breaking the bank while also providing an opportunity for high stakes regulars to satisfy their desire to play for eye watering sums of money. The high volume means the series comes with a healthy $4,000,000 in total guarantees, including a sizable $3,000,000 set aside for the $5,300 Main Event.

Song Takes Out Dieleman

Nivel 12 : Blinds 1,000/2,000, 2,000 ante

Marcus Dieleman got his last 7,000 in the middle from the big blind on a flop of 954 and Stephen Song called on the button.

Marcus Dieleman: 96 All in
Stephen Song: K10

Dieleman was ahead with a pair of nines, but Song hit the 10 on the turn to make a pair of tens. The river was the 7 and Dieleman was sent to the rail.
